    I went to one of the Freedom/DCU double header's last season and had a great time. The attendance was poor for the WPS game but went up when DCU started and the cost of the ticket was the same of a regular DCU match. While I had a great time watching two stellar games, I don't think it would bring in enough revenue for SBFC to come out even. I'd be suprised if NYRB fan's came early to watch the blues. Though marketing can do anything...I hope you prove me wrong! I will definitely make it out if there is a double header.

    I went to the DCU/Fire-Freedom/Red Stars doubleheader game last year in DC. Most of the DCU fans came in just before the DCU/Fire game. I asked some people why the DCU fans didn't come in earlier to watch the WPS game and most of the feedback I got was that DCU fans stayed in the parking lots to tailgate and party because you can't go in and out of the stadium. Cheaper to drink outside then buy the expensive beer in the stadium. Sp maybe catching a buzz before you start jumping up and down is more important to some fans. But I did think there was a decent crowd for the WPS game. It was just that they were dispersed all over the huge RFK stadium.

    As far as cost, I don't see nothing wrong with one or two doubleheaders for exposure. I don't think a doubleheader or two will break the bank for iether one. And I'm sure there those here who would say that WPS does not need MLS to validate itself and I agree, but IMO having doubleheaders with MLS only adds credibility to WPS.

    I say go for it if the logistics and who gets what money can be worked out. WPS and MLS teams in the same towns should have good working relationships. It's good for the pro game in this country. IMO.
